The Analyses for power systems are more necessary for the designing, operating phase execution control and to make sure safe network operations by sufficient protection project settings. In this article, we have prepared a sufficient scientific survey about the electrical model of a 340 MW integrated solar combined cycle system (ISCCS) located in the Iraqi southern, is developed and simulation by a program called Electrical Transient Analyzer Program (ETAP) and carry out throw this program the load flow, voltage stability and short circuit analyses for this power plant with part of the national grid in Al-Basra city in an industrial region. The effect of voltage instability for the grid on system buses (load buses) of the power system is estimated. By using load flow analysis as a case study by using the Newton-Raphson algorithm, when the load buses operating at down voltage because of instability voltage of the power grid are specified and their voltages are should to improved according to given voltage limitations that are depended on buses criticality with regard to loads. The appliance on-load tap changers of the transformer and reactive power compensation are used to improve steady-state voltage stability for any instability system. The method of the optimal position for capacitor banks placement is meaning the number of capacitor banks is proposed to adding to the weak buses by using the optimal capacitor placement module of ETAP. Abstract—Home Security Alarms in today's modern society only use CCTV that can only see the person without any notification that goes into the cellphone in dealing with the theft that occurred. To help the community in dealing with the theft that enters the house, a Home Security Alarm was made using WEMOS D1 and HC-SR501 Sensor with Telegram Notification. The whole tool is divided into several parts which consist of HC-SR501 Sensor, WEMOS D1 and Buzzer. This tool works when the WEMOS D1 microcontroller processes the pear sensor as a motion detector and buzzer as a sound alarm if motion is detected, then the notification automatically enters into the Telegram Application, With this tool can monitor directly if anyone enters the house while being leftKeywords— Wemos D1, Sensor HC-SR501, Telegram, CCTV, Buzzer.

Dehydration is a condition where the body are lack of fluids. It is because the amount of fluid that enter in the body is less of fluid than the discharge. Dehydration is something that cannot be ignored. The high incidence of dehydration is due to the difficulty of seeing the signs and symptoms of dehydration for ordinary people. This tool is designed to handle the level of human dehydration by seeing whether the urine is normal or abnormal, whether is it mild dehydration, or severe dehydration. It can handled based on the color of the urine using a tool named Light Emitting Diode Sensor (LED) and a light dependent resistor (LDR). Tool innovation is the use of rechargeable batteries and a charger module to make it easier for users to recharge exhausted batteries. On the LCD also displays the proportion of the battery to make it easier for users to see the remaining battery weaponry. This tool is expected to be able to check the dehydration among the public in order to achieve the public health status. After the process of designing, testing, collecting and analyzing data on 15 samples and reading 20 times for each sample, the result is that the tool can work well, can measure the level of dehydration according to the human urine with an average value of 62.10. The reading results that appear on the LCD are the same or according to the level of dehydration shown on the urine color chart.

In this research, a grid search is employed to find the optimal parameter and an optimized K-Nearest Neighbor (KNN) based breast cancer detection model is proposed. The grid search is used to find the best combinations of parameters that could produce better breast cancer detection accuracy. Moreover, this study explored the effect of parameter tuning on the performance of KNN algorithm foe breast cancer detection. The findings of this research reveals that parameter tuning has a significant effect on the performance of the proposed model. The effect of parameter tuning on the performance of KNN algorithm is experimentally tested using Wisconsin breast cancer dataset collected from kaggle data repository. Finally, we have compared the performance of the KNN algorithm with the tuned hyper-parameter and with default hyper-parameter. The result analysis on the performance of the KNN algorithm on breast cancer detection on the test dataset reveals that the accuracy of the proposed optimized model is 94.35% and the performance of the KNN algorithm with the default hyper-parameter is 90.10%.

Noise is unwanted signals in a communication or information system. Kalman filter has a good ability to handle noise. This study uses the Kalman filter algorithm that works to reduce noise at the accelerometer and gyroscope sensor output. Data were taken using the accelerometer sensor and the gyroscope sensor in a stationary condition. The device is Arduino Uno for processing the data and MPU6050 for accelerometer and gyroscope sensor. In the Kalman filter algorithm, there is process variance matrix and measurement variance matrix parameters that affect noise attenuation or reduction at the accelerometer and gyroscope output. If the difference between the two parameters is too large, then the attenuation becomes very large and eliminates the original value of the sensor output. Thus, the value cannot be chosen carelessly. The best value is the measurement variance matrix must bigger than the process variance matrix.

Embedding is an anatomical pathology laboratory device that is very important for producing quality slices and is also a device used to process paraffin tissue, so that the tissue can be cut with higher precision using a microtom (slicer). From the process of melting paraffin crystals using a manual heating process with bunsen flame heaters (fire heaters) so that the paraffin crystals can be transformed from the crystal into liquid. While paraffin crystals that have been processed from the crystal to liquid form are poured into the mold and left to freeze. In this case, an embedding system device will be made equipped with heating and cooling. The temperature used for the liquefaction process is 50ï‚°C while the temperature for cooling is 17ï‚°C. After making the process of making device, experiment device, and retrieving data, the error percentage results were 0.016% at the heating temperature and 0.08% at the coolant temperature, and the percentage of heating samples obtained in the sample was 61.3%, while the percentage samples for parts coolers get a value of 92%
